Back to Job Search

Job Description

We are currently looking for a Country Manager to join an expanding offshore company based in Africa.

Our client seeks an experienced Country or General Manager to lead our the commercial and operations of the fleet. Key responsibilities include developing and implementing strategies, optimizing performance, identifying new business opportunities, and maintaining client relationships. The role involves managing operational, commercial, financial, legal, and HR activities, ensuring compliance with all regulations and achieving targets.

Qualifications:
  • MBA or related diploma in marketing, commercial affairs, maritime, or international business.
  • Minimum 5 years’ experience in sales/marketing/business unit management, preferably in the oil/shipping sector.
  • Fluency in English and Portuguese.